Alternative document type definitions for Micro Focus Content Manager

You can customize how document types are mapped for a Micro Focus Content Manager EDM provider.

Normally the Document Type field in Infor Public Sector corresponds to a document type field in the EDM system, and the document type names in Infor Public Sector must match the names used in the EDM system.

The document type field that is normally used in Micro Focus Content Manager is called Record Type, but you can optionally map the Infor Public Sector Document Type field to a different field. In addition, you can map the names of Infor Public Sector document types to different values in Micro Focus Content Manager, so the names don't always need to match.

To configure an alternative document type field, use the Alternative Type Definition Field node under the Micro Focus Content Manager node in the DocumentProviders configuration. The Document Type Field attribute on the Alternative Type Definition Field node specifies the field in Micro Focus Content Manager that will be used for the document type.

To map document type names, add a child Record Type Mappings node to the Alternative Type Definition Field node. The mappings are defined in child Record Type Mapping nodes, where the Document Type Reference Id attribute specifies a document type in Infor Public Sector and the Record Type specifies the corresponding type in Micro Focus Content Manager.

You can also use the Default Record Type attribute on the Alternative Type Definition Field node to specify a default to use for any document types that aren't mapped.
